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elenskyy met with newly appointed UK Prime Minister Andy Burnham at a British naval base in Portsmouth, England. This marked Burnham's first meeting with a foreign leader since taking office.

The discussions centered on critical defense cooperation, including joint drone production, Ukraine's urgent need for ballistic missile interceptors, and maritime security. Prime Minister Burnham pledged the UK's "unwavering" support for Kyiv and committed to sharing intellectual property for the "Stone Cloak" electronic warfare system.

Burnham stated that the UK would honor all its commitments to Ukraine. Zelenskyy described the bilateral relationship as "stronger than ever." The leaders also met with over 200 Ukrainian military personnel participating in a training exercise focused on combat capabilities and Black Sea mine countermeasures.

President Zelenskyy is scheduled to visit US President Donald Trump in Washington the following day.
